The University of Tromsø currently has a vacant research fellow position for an applicant who wants to pursue a PhD degree in theoretical and/or experimental linguistics. The successful applicant will propose a research project that is compatible with ongoing work at CASTL (see URL above). The Center for Advanced Study in Theoretical Linguistics (CASTL) is a Norwegian Center of Excellence funded by the Research Council of Norway and the University of Tromsø. The core scientific group of the center currently consists of 6 senior researchers, 9 postdocs/researchers and 17 PhD students. CASTL's primary research activity is within generative grammar with a focus on syntax, phonology, and language acquisition. CASTL also runs a Graduate School. The person hired in the advertised position is expected to follow the program of the Graduate School and to complete a doctoral dissertation. A more detailed plan for coursework, research, and teaching will be developed by the employee together with the Graduate School Coordinator shortly after appointment.
